Braunston Parish Council consists of 7 elected members who serve for a 4 year term. Council meetings are held in the village hall on the 2nd Thursday of every other month, and the attendance of members of the public is welcomed.
The council maintains green spaces, the play area, and street lighting in the parish, and liaises with Rutland County Council and other bodies on wider issues.
